Common Device Issues and Their Signs and symptoms
When your appliances start acting up, it's necessary to recognize the signs beforehand. Neglecting them can lead to bigger problems and expensive fixings. If your refrigerator isn't cooling down correctly, you might see cozy areas or condensation forming. This might show a failing compressor or a blocked vent.Your dishwashing machine might show problems via unclean meals or uncommon noises during cycles. If you hear grinding or clanking, it's time to investigate.A washing device that won't spin or drain pipes can leave you with soggy washing, recommending a clogged drain or a malfunctioning pump.Lastly, if your stove's temperature level seems off or it takes permanently to preheat, you may be taking care of a malfunctioning thermostat. By remaining sharp to these signs, you can deal with problems before they rise right into major fixings.

Electrical Screening Devices
Along with basic hand tools, electrical testing gadgets play a crucial duty in appliance repair service. These tools aid you detect electrical issues and warranty appliances function safely. A multimeter is essential; it gauges voltage, present, and resistance, allowing you to identify issues swiftly. A non-contact voltage tester is one more must-have, allowing you discover online wires without making direct call, boosting your security. Secure meters are wonderful for determining existing circulation in cables without separating them, saving you time and effort. In addition, circuit testers can quickly check if electrical outlets are working appropriately. By utilizing these devices, you'll streamline your troubleshooting procedure and enhance your repair abilities, making appliance upkeep a great deal easier.

Troubleshooting Laundry Equipments: Tips and Techniques
When your washing home appliances start breaking down, it can really feel overwhelming, yet repairing them does not have to be a headache. Start by inspecting the power supply. Validate the appliance is connected in and the electrical outlet is working. Next off, evaluate the door or cover button; a faulty button can avoid the equipment from operating.For washing machines, if it's not rotating, inspect for out of balance tons. Rearranging the garments could fix the issue. If your dryer isn't heating, clean the dust filter and check the vent for blockages.Listen for uncommon noises; they can suggest an issue. If your home appliance is leaking, check the tubes for splits or loose connections. File any error codes presented on digital displays, as they can lead you in identifying the problem. Get in touch with the individual manual for details troubleshooting suggestions related to your design.
